Basic Peace Officer Examination

What is the Basic Peace Officer Exam?
A certification exam for peace officers in the state of Texas.  The exam is a computer-based test.

This test is only offered to SPC Law Enforcement / Academy Students.

Information regarding the Basic Peace Officer Exam:

  • Test is 250 questions and you have 2 hours and 45 minutes to complete.

  • Results are printed after the exam.
